Betty Jean Yates McElreath, 83, of Trinity, passed away Tuesday, August 31, 2021, at Woodland Hill Center in Asheboro. A funeral service will be conducted at 11:00 a.m. Saturday, September 4, 2021, at Ridge Funeral Home Chapel with Pastor Junior Summey and Rev. Fred Huffstetler officiating. Burial will follow at Pierce's Chapel Primitive Baptist Church Cemetery. Betty was born on February 25, 1938, in Randolph Co. to the late John William Yates and Virgie Louise Gallimore Yates. She retired from Sew Special. She was a loving sister and an aunt to many. In addition to her parents, Betty was preceded in death by her Husband Hoyt McElreath; and brother, Billy Joe Yates. She is survived by her sister, Joyce Mitchell and husband Wesley of Asheboro; sister-in-law, Vickie Yates; nieces and nephews, Jack Mitchell of Jackson Creek, Denise Davis and husband David of Randleman, Greg Yates and wife Michelle of Lexington, Christy McGuire of Lexington; great nieces and nephews, Caroline Davis, Hannah Davis, Ashley Pyne and husband Cody, Derrick Yates, Stephanie Seay and husband Michael, Javan McGuire and wife Taylor, Charity Johnson and husband Baylen, Bethany Yates, and Bethany Barton. Mrs. McElreath will lie in repose from 3:00 until 7:00 p.m., Friday, September 3, 2021 at Ridge Funeral Home. Memorials may be made to Hospice of Randolph, 416 Vision Drive, Asheboro, NC 27203; or to American Cancer Society, 4-A Oak Branch Dr., Greensboro, NC 27407.
